segment one: The Foundation: Sustainable Uncooked components

the selection of raw materials is considered the most essential factor in deciding the environmental footprint of a t-shirt. let us analyze The true secret differences involving conventional and sustainable alternatives:

organic and natural Cotton: A Pesticide-absolutely free Paradise:

the trouble with common Cotton: classic cotton farming is notorious for its significant reliance on artificial pesticides, herbicides, and fertilizers. These chemicals can pollute waterways, hurt wildlife, and pose overall health challenges to farmers. typical cotton also calls for broad amounts of h2o, contributing to drinking water scarcity in certain locations.

The natural and organic Option: natural cotton is developed without the use of synthetic pesticides or fertilizers. This shields soil wellness, lessens drinking water pollution, and promotes biodiversity. natural and organic cotton farming also prioritizes the health and fitness and safety of farmers.

GOTS Certification: The Gold Standard: Look for the worldwide organic and natural Textile conventional (GOTS) certification in order that your t-shirt is produced from really organic and natural cotton and that all the offer chain adheres to stringent environmental and social requirements. GOTS certification addresses everything from your cultivation of the cotton to your dyeing and ending procedures.

Linen: mother nature's potent and Sustainable Fiber:

Flax: A Resilient Crop: Linen is derived from your flax plant, a In a natural way resilient crop that requires drastically considerably less water and pesticides than cotton. Flax also thrives in bad soil conditions, making it a more sustainable choice for agriculture.

sturdiness and Breathability: Linen fibers are robust and sturdy, earning linen t-shirts prolonged-Long lasting. Linen is likewise highly breathable and absorbent, making it a snug option for heat temperature.

Hemp: The Carbon-adverse Champion:

fast advancement and Carbon Sequestration: Hemp is really a speedily renewable useful resource that needs nominal water and pesticides. Hemp also boasts Outstanding carbon sequestration abilities, absorbing additional CO2 with the environment than many other crops.

power and Versatility: Hemp fibers are very strong and sturdy, generating them perfect for lengthy-lasting clothes. Hemp fabric can also be flexible and will be blended with other fibers to generate many different textures and types.

Recycled Fibers: supplying Waste a fresh everyday living:

Recycled Polyester (rPET): Turning Plastic into trend: rPET is made from recycled plastic bottles, diverting them from landfills and lowering our reliance on virgin petroleum. rPET output involves fewer energy than virgin polyester output.

The GRS normal: The Global Recycled common (GRS) certification makes certain that the recycled content material as part of your t-shirt is confirmed and traceable. GRS also addresses social and environmental problems within the creation course of action.

Recycled Cotton: Reusing Textile Scraps: Recycled cotton is designed from textile scraps and pre-client squander. This lowers the need For brand spanking new cotton cultivation and helps to close the loop on textile squander.

Bio-centered Synthetic Fibers: Bridging Nature and engineering:

Tencel (Lyocell): The Wood Pulp speculate: Tencel is comprised of sustainably sourced Wooden pulp, normally from eucalyptus trees grown on sustainably managed plantations. The output system employs a shut-loop process, recycling Nearly all the water and solvents applied.

Softness and Sustainability: Tencel is noted for its Fantastic softness, breathability, and drape. It's also biodegradable and compostable underneath the right conditions.

Modal: Beech Tree Bliss: comparable to Tencel, Modal is derived from beech tree pulp. It is unbelievably comfortable, proof against shrinkage, and drapes wonderfully. Modal needs less drinking water and energy to supply than standard rayon.

segment two: past the Material: Sustainable production tactics

picking sustainable resources is just step one. It is also essential to consider the producing processes applied to create your t-shirt:

h2o Conservation:

Textile dyeing and ending are h2o-intense procedures. hunt for models that use water-effective dyeing strategies and wastewater remedy systems.

Energy performance:

select manufacturers that prioritize Vitality performance within their production services. This could certainly involve applying renewable Vitality resources and applying Vitality-saving measures.

Chemical administration:

Sustainable producing includes reducing using unsafe chemicals and applying demanding chemical management protocols.

honest Labor Practices:

Support models that prioritize fair labor techniques and make sure that employees are treated with regard and paid out a residing wage.

portion three: The Chemical Checklist: making sure Toxin-free of charge Tees

The existence of damaging chemical compounds in t-shirts can pose risks to both of those buyers along with the ecosystem.

Restricted Substance Lists (RSLs):

make sure that your t-shirt is cost-free from unsafe substances like azo dyes, formaldehyde, phthalates, and weighty metals.

OEKO-TEX Certification:

try to find the OEKO-TEX normal a hundred certification, which verifies that The material has actually been analyzed for harmful substances which is Harmless for human Get hold of.

organic Dyes:

think about t-shirts dyed with all-natural dyes derived from vegetation, minerals, or insects. all-natural dyes can be quite a much more sustainable alternative to synthetic dyes, but it is vital making sure that they are ethically and sustainably sourced.

segment four: Fiber Blends: knowing the Composition

The composition of one's t-shirt's fabric can effect its toughness, ease and comfort, and recyclability.

The benefits and drawbacks of Blends:

Mixing diverse fibers can greatly enhance the effectiveness and durability of a t-shirt. having said that, blends may make recycling more challenging.

Prioritizing Sustainable Fibers in Blends:

If you end up picking a mix, hunt for t-shirts that has a higher percentage of recycled or natural and organic fibers.

segment five: lengthy-Long lasting type: Durability and treatment

A durable t-shirt is actually a sustainable t-shirt. The lengthier it is possible to have on a garment, the fewer typically you must change it.

Fabric good quality:

select t-shirts made out of high-good quality fabrics that happen to be immune to pilling, shrinking, and fading.

Construction:

search for t-shirts with very well-constructed seams and bolstered stitching.

good treatment:

Stick to the treatment Guidance to the garment label to extend the life of your t-shirt. clean your t-shirts in cold drinking water, stay clear of employing severe detergents, and line dry Every time feasible.

part 7: The End of existence: Recycling and Composting

contemplate what occurs in your t-shirt when you are concluded with it.

Recycling packages:

Some manufacturers supply consider-back again packages for old t-shirts, allowing for you to recycle your clothes responsibly.

Composting:

T-shirts made out of normal fibers like cotton, linen, and hemp might be composted at your house or within an industrial composting facility.
